Company Overview

Worley is a global professional services company focused on energy, chemicals, and resources. We partner with customers to deliver projects and create value over asset lifecycles, bridging traditional energy sources with sustainable energy solutions.

Purpose

Applying in-depth knowledge, advanced problem solving, and awareness of internal and client priorities to implement project scope and objectives. Developing independent judgment, leading larger workstreams, and fostering internal team development and client relationships.

Responsibilities
  • Ownership of smaller assignments/projects, including team and client engagement, and developing case studies.
  • Engaging with clients at higher levels, managing relationships, and supporting account growth.
  • Responsible for a portion of project revenue, understanding its impact on business outcomes.
  • Interfacing with other workstreams, managing priorities, and addressing complex situations.
  • Breaking down and structuring complex problems independently.
  • Conferring with managers on complex assignments, updating on progress.
  • Resolving conflicts, influencing organizational direction, and guiding team strategy.
  • Communicating complex proposals effectively to senior management, persuading and influencing others.
Qualifications

What you will bring:

  • Experienced Power Engineer, preferably with Mechanical Engineering background.
  • Knowledge of diverse power technologies and owner's engineering services.
  • Construction/commissioning experience is a plus.
  • Understanding of project scheduling, Primavera, and techno-economic modeling.
  • Team player with remote team management skills.
  • HSE awareness, project budgeting, and proposal drafting skills.
  • Knowledge of project contractual arrangements.
